ufopaedia seems most logical cause you see item statistics, names and total count.
is not the best but is the simplest way to add it into the game.

No, I must disagree. There are several reason why ufopedia is a bad place for this.

1/ in the UFOpedia you see only researched items... what will you do if you want to see how many plasma rifles do you have, but you haven't researched them?

2/ Store items and Ufopedia items do not match 1:1... if you want to see how many sectoid corpses do you have, you could go to Ufopedia... but there is no article about sectoid corpses there... there is only article about sectoid autopsy... and there is no (reasonable) link between the corpse and the autopsy to show the correct number. Not to mention that the link might be a lot more complicated than the one just described.

3/ Ufopedia can show several items at once (e.g. heavy cannon, ammo AP, ammo HE, ammo IN)... where would we place 4 new labels?

4/ Technically (source-code-wise), Ufopedia articles are not the same as Items... they sometimes match, but it's more an exception than a rule. Finding corresponding item/items for a ufopedia article would be a real pain to implement. Possible, but really painful.

5/ Lastly, I don't know about you, but when I look for item count, I don't need to know the description/statistics about it, I am interested only in the total number. But maybe you have a use case for that...

ideally you would want something like base stores but outside the base menu in the main menu

Yes, that's what I proposed earlier.

A good idea but the Pedia is, I think, a very bad place for this kind of info. Maybe some sort of 'show all/show this base' toggle under the General Stores menu?

OK, I decided for this option instead of global hotkey from geoscape.

Sorting by space used (by toggle button) has been replaced by sorting arrows (similar to load/save dialog), and you can now sort by all columns (name, quantity, size, space used) ascending and descending.

The toggle button has been renamed to "Grand Total", which displays "all items", including:
1. all items in stores from all bases
2a. all items in craft from all bases (both parked in hangar and out there flying around)
2b. all craft weapons and ammo
2c. all craft vehicles and ammo
3. all armor worn by soldiers
4. all items and aliens currently being researched/interrogated
5a. all items in transfer
5b. all craft equipment, craft weapons+ammo and craft vehicles+ammo in transfer

I hope I didn't forget anything  :-\

It will NOT show:
a/ soldiers
b/ engineers/scientists
c/ craft (names)

See attached screenshot.

EDIT: I didn't implement the "watchlist", because you can now sort by name and find your item relatively quickly... if you know what you're looking for  ;)
